What to Know Before You Arrive

We hope you get the best out of your Dino experience at the Memphis Zoo. Please take our advice and follow these tips to plan your visit:

  • Dinosaurs at the Memphis Zoo will be open March 10 - July 8, 2012, 9 a.m. to 5:30 p.m. Daily
  • There is an extra fee for the Dinosaur exhibit.  Zoo Members pay $3; Nonmembers $4. Join today!
  • Your ticket purchase is valid for one entry to the exhibit per day.
  • The exhibit will include 15 dinosaurs and will be located in the old eagle aviary located behind the Elephant's Trunk Gift Shop.
  • If you visit us on a weekday during the months of March-May, plan to come Monday, Tuesday or Wednesday. We're expecting large school groups on Thursdays and Fridays. 
  • Purchase tickets upon your arrival to the Zoo's front gate or the Dinosaur exhibit entrance.
  • Pick up a treasure map on your way into the exhibit to navigate your way through the Dino terrain!
  • Take advantage of a Dino keeper chat in front of the exhibit entrance at 10:30 a.m., 12:30 p.m. and 2:30 p.m. daily.
  •  Visit the Dino Dig Shop and extend your time with the Dinosaurs with our educational Dino books and toys.
  • A picture is worth a thousand ROARS! Be sure to get your souvenir picture taken inside the exhibit.
  • Bring your smartphone! Each of our dino signs have QR codes to provide you with additional information about each dinosaur. Plus, when you download the Zoo's iphone app, you can use the Photo Booth feature to take fun photos in the exhibit!
